The contract pertains to the procurement of a new manufactured material specifically identified as the J85 Rotor, Compressor, AI, with the National Stock Number 2840-01-630-9064 and part number 5126T28G11. This rotor is designed for use in the J85 engine and is constructed from Inconel 718 for the body and AM355 Steel for the blades, weighing 70 pounds and measuring 27 inches in length, and approximately 15.78 inches in width and height. Its function involves compressing air through eight stages of rotor blades into the combustion section for engine ignition. The solicitation, identified as RFP SPRTA1-26-R-0202, is managed by the Department of Defense’s DLA Aviation at Tinker Air Force Base, Oklahoma, with an anticipated request for proposals (RFP) release on April 13, 2026, and a response deadline on May 13, 2026. The government plans to order an estimated quantity of 488 units with a quantity range between 125 and 748, with delivery scheduled by October 31, 2028. This procurement will be conducted under FAR Part 12, focusing on the acquisition of commercial items, and will follow electronic procedures exclusively for solicitation requests, allowing only written or faxed communications. GE Aviation, currently the sole known capable source, is recognized under CAGE code 99207, and the government intends to limit competition accordingly under FAR 6.302 authority. An appointed Ombudsman is available to address contractor concerns confidentially during the proposal phase, but does not influence proposal evaluation or source selection. Interested parties are encouraged to express their capability within 15 days of the notice, and the full solicitation will be available for download from sam.gov upon release. All questions should be directed to Breann Irving at the provided contact information, and fax requests can be submitted to the designated DLA Aviation office. Export controls are not applicable for this procurement.
